Hi,

I would like to update LLVM, including clang, lld and lldb, to the
patch release version 5.0.1.  They typically only do bugfixing, which
means that the diff to 5.0.0 is "only" about 3500 lines.

I don't expect any big fallout, but I would appreciate if someone
could do a ports run with this change.  I will take care of src/x11
on amd64.

Update procedure is simply running
  $ cd /usr/src/gnu/usr.bin/clang
  $ make obj
  $ make clean
  $ make -j8
  $ make install

Feedback appreciated!
